I am having the builder come around tonight to quote installation what would you say the ball park for this would be. I need a single double hung window taken out and then the opening made wider to install the double doors.
It will depend on a couple of things:
(1)Does the timber lintel need to be changed due to spanning a bigger distance?
(2)Removal of existing window
(3)Cut remove brickwork/cladding
(4)Removal of plaster, installation of window studs
(5)Marrying th enew sill into the floor, is it timber, concrete, carpet???
(6)Any services need relocating (electrical, plumbing etc)
(7)Supply and install of new architraves, mods to skirting etc
(8)Does the steel brick lintel need to be changed due to increased span?
If it was a straight cut out old window and fit new doors, should only be around $800-$1000, obviously the more work involved etc the price will go up.
We did a job for a client like this, we had to cut the double brick work out, and install steel lintels to both sides of the brick work, built a custom reveal (250mm+)
Married the new sill into the timber floor, skirting and architraves to both sides of the new window was around $3500 for two windows.
As you can see on the left hand side, the smaller window of the two has had the arcs put on and the sliding door was just about to have its archs installed.
We went to big lenghts to cover everything in plastic, as we had to wet cut with a demo saw inside the house.
Hope this gives you an idea of whats involved.
